Description
To deliver these kind of treated radioactive waste, waste generator should show that this solidified radioactive wastes should have physical integrity by ensuring the results of consecutive tests such as compressive strength, leaching and immersion, thermal cycling and free standing liquid, which should be implemented based on the test plan and procedure. The series of test requirements of standards is established a couple of decade ago primarily guidance for cement based solidified radioactive waste. However today there are various solidification agent and immobilization technologies like paraffin and vitrification and etc. is being developed and available in laboratory level. Thus it is recommended that all the testing required for solidified radioactive waste be discussed for confirmation. Also a serious of independent test such as compressive strength, immersion and leaching, thermal cycling, voidage, irradiation and other chemical characteristics testing should be reviewed and upgraded for solidified radioactive waste, and its relationship and interoperability among tests should be discussed.
